The Clippers are amazingly in 6th place in the Western Conference… proving that there are no good teams in the west after the #5 Denver Nuggets….. And even Denver is holding on by a thread.  The Clippers as a franchise made the classic mistake… In the summer of 2017, they determined the combination of Chris Paul and Blake Griffin and the role players around them would be able to go no further than a game away from the conference finals… so they traded CP# for 4 quality role players and a first round pick.  They then signed Blake Griffin to a max contract extension and the moment they could they traded Blake to the Detroit Pistons for Avery Bradley, Tobias Harris, Boban Marjanovic, and a future 1st round pick, but since it was a three way trade the Clippers also got Center Willie Reed and forward Brice Johnson…. So they were left with a team loaded with guys who weren’t all-stars, but all of them could play.  Plus they had a big bag of future draft picks including their own. … Then the mistake happened, the brain trust of the Clippers sold the new, enthusiastic, multi-billionaire owner on a franchise destroying path to trade every asset and every pick they had in the bag… for Paul George in order to sign.. Kawhi Leonard as a free agent.  They emptied the shelves for two guys who both had a history of missing entire seasons due to knee injuries.  Kahwi went down with another knee injury, if he never gets better soon it will be a decade before the Clippers can rebuild.  The Clippers are on a three-game losing streak against the Utah Jazz, the Oklahoma City Thunder, and the San Antonio Spurs.  Anyone can beat them at any time.

The Sacramento Kings have always been bad… they didn’t just stumble into it because of poor trading and a knee injury.  The Kings build slowly and poorly.  They always are in a good draft position and rarely do they come up with the gem.  Plus they can’t get free agents because they are a cow town with nothing exciting going on and you have to pay California state taxes to live there… players sign there only if no one else wants them and the straw that broke the camel’s back is they never trade well either.  The Kings lost their last game to the Golden State Warriors 113-98. Several players on both sides missed because of Covid… if they all had played the result would have been the same. The Kings are fodder… they win some, they lose most.

Los Angeles Clippers vs Sacramento Kings Preview and Analysis

Recent Form

The Los Angeles Clippers are 16-15 on the season, but 13-18 ATS.  They have logged 13 Overs and 18 Unders.  They are 4-7 in road games.

The Sacramento Kings are 13-19 on the season, but 14-18 ATS.  They have notched 15 Overs, 16 Unders, and 1 Push.  They are 7-9 in home games.

Offensive Analysis

The Clippers are 25th in the league in points with 105.5 per game, 23rd in rebounds with 43.9 per, and 24th in AST/TO ratio with 1.5.  They are shooting as if Rajon Rondo is on the team, 21st in FG%, 10th in 3PT%, and 14th in FT%.  Defensively they are playing well as if they have Rajon Rondo on the roster 8th in defense of points with 105.3, 9th in defense of FG% and 8th in defense of 3PT%.

The Kings are 6th in the league in scoring with 110.8 ppg, 16th in rebounds with 44.8, 22nd in AST/TO ratio with 1.6.  They are shooting 16th in FG%, 24th in 3PT%, and 25th in FT%.... The offensive numbers are good the way you’d imagine a young team loaded with athletic talent would be…. The problem is the defense.  They are 29th and allow 114.3 ppg… you won’t win many games with that type of effort.  Fortunately the Kings relieved Luke Walton of his clipboard and filled the spot with veteran head coach Alvin Gentry.  They need defense and the front office should be looking to find it.
